While Dodgers chairman Mark Walter said famously that “pitchers break,” he didn’t balk at signing Yoshinobu Yamamoto to a 12-year, $325 million contract over the winter. But he never said anything about shortstops breaking. And in the space of about 24 hours, Walter has seen his club…
